Helpful Tips To Help Out Mom And Dad Fix Their Baby Sleep Problems
Does your baby sleep peacefully at night and then suddenly wakes up at the course of his/her sleep crying while looking for mother and father? Well this could be due to a bad dream, night terrors or snore. If that is so, listed below are some tips to help you with how to avoid toddler sleep problems from waking your little one at night and also to help you as a parent to gain plenty of sleep as well.
Stay in Bed
Your little kids still need some help before they are going to sleep on their own. Be sure that you accompany them as they get to sleep at night, and not just leave them on other people's attention. More often than not, your child would certainly adore the feeling of rocking in your arms before they could feel asleep calmly. However you really don't need to rock your baby at all times before they sleep, you can just pat their back gently, to simply let them be aware of your existence. The actual thought of having you right beside them on bed makes them want to sleep peacefully for the reason that they will feel secure as well as comfy.
Observe Proper Daytime Sleeping
Take note that having inadequate or too much sleep at daytime can also be a hindrance to your child's sleep at nighttime. In fact, it is by far the most common toddler sleep troubles simply because lack of sleep could make your little one so tired, and little ones who might be overtired can become very hyperactive at night that you will definitely have a hard time in getting them to get to sleep. Meanwhile, if your child is taking a four to 5 hours nap in the afternoon, he/she might not be set yet to sleep during the night, not until middle of the night!
Be Mindful of any Sleep Disorder
When you think that your baby have been waking up on a regular basis at night, right in the middle of his/her sleep, consider seeking the assistance of your child's pediatrician since this could possibly be a symptom of a more critical kid sleep problems. If you hear your child snoring while in his/her sleep, this can be a sign that he/she is suffering from obstructive sleep apnea (OSA). So make sure to consult your doctor if you hear your child frequently snores during the night and does not appear to feel rested when sunrise comes.
